ALS model contains RDDs. So you cannot put `model.recommendProducts`
inside a RDD closure `userProductsRDD.map`. -Xiangrui

There is a JIRA for it: https://issues.apache.org/jira/browse/SPARK-3066
The easiest case is when one side is small. If both sides are large,
this is a super-expensive operation. We can do block-wise cross
product and then find top-k for each user.
